Transaction ec254224e042942a9804f72c624a7363e33de106f10822ea4c64245a0779a93d

1 Input
2 Outputs
  • ec254224e042942a9804f72c624a7363e33de106f10822ea4c64245a0779a93d:0
  • value  950393
    address  1CZfs2UcwcqnN88GuQK6ZGPiTu7rNsr8Gc
  • ec254224e042942a9804f72c624a7363e33de106f10822ea4c64245a0779a93d:1
  • value  2385836
    address  bc1q6sqpye229uu9nxecjh0ax2ruwwh8p75hvcdj4p